Describing compassion fatigue from the perspective of oncology nurses in Durban, South Africa.
Dorien L WentzelAnthony CollinsPetra BrysiewiczPublished in: Health SA = SA Gesondheid (2019)
The findings revealed that oncology nurses are affected emotionally in caring for their patients, thus making them prone to compassion fatigue. Oncology nurses need to acknowledge compassion fatigue and be able to self-reflect on how they are managing (both positively and negatively) with the stressors encountered in the oncology wards or units.
